A safety toe is impact and compression protection, not electrical isolation. ASTM F2413 treats them as separate ratings: only a boot carrying the EH mark is tested for secondary protection against open electrical circuits, and that protection is voided by wet soles, worn outsoles or embedded metal. Work on or near energised parts is controlled by a zero-energy state and the NFPA 70E arc-flash program first; footwear is the last layer, never the plan.

The Timberland PRO Titan EV is a 6-inch waterproof work boot with a non-metallic ASTM F2413 composite safety toe and an anti-fatigue footbed in a trimmer athletic leather profile.

Key features

  • Non-metallic composite safety toe meets ASTM F2413 impact and compression
  • Trimmer athletic leather profile over the rebuilt Titan platform
  • Waterproof leather upper for wet-ground work
  • Timberland PRO anti-fatigue footbed for long shifts
  • Lightweight for a leather safety boot
  • Metal-free build passes detectors and resists cold transfer

Specifications

Safety toe Composite (non-metallic), ASTM F2413 I/75 C/75
Waterproof Yes
Height 6 inch
Profile Trim athletic, Titan platform
Footbed Timberland PRO anti-fatigue
Sizes 8-13 (US men)
Best for Trades wanting leather durability with mobility

Fit, sizing, and metal-free advantage

The Titan EV runs true to size but on a trimmer last; wide-footed wearers should order a half size up. Frequently Asked Questions

Is the Timberland PRO Titan EV metal-free?
Yes. The Titan EV uses a non-metallic composite safety toe that meets ASTM F2413, so it is lighter than steel and clears metal detectors.
Is the Titan EV waterproof?
Yes, it has a waterproof leather upper for wet ground and rain. It is not insulated for deep cold.
What size should I order in the Titan EV?
It runs true to size on a trim athletic last. Wide-footed wearers should order a half size up.
How does the Titan EV differ from the Morphix?
The Titan EV uses a trimmer leather build for durability; the Morphix is a sneaker-style hybrid for maximum lightness. Both are waterproof composite.
Does the composite toe meet the same rating as steel?
Yes. The Titan EV composite toe meets ASTM F2413 I/75 C/75, the same impact and compression class as steel, at a lower weight.
Is the Titan EV good for all-day standing?
Yes. The Timberland PRO anti-fatigue footbed is built for long shifts on hard floors; add a cushioned insole for extra comfort.
Will the Titan EV pass through a metal detector?
Yes. Its metal-free composite toe and construction are designed to clear detectors at airports and secure sites.
Is the Titan EV insulated?
No. It is a waterproof, non-insulated boot. For cold weather choose an insulated composite or steel model.
Does the Titan EV run narrow?
The trim athletic last runs slightly narrow. Wide-footed wearers should size up a half or choose the roomier Boondock.
